The vehicles participating in this category are 1:10 scale models equipped with sensors and actuators similar to those that would be found in a real vehicle. The direct antecedent of this category is the project \u201cVisions of urban mobility\u201d, directed by Dr. Raul Rojas, from the Free University of Berlin.
